Active, engaging digital learning is a crucial element of the modern workplace. As L&D professionals prepare for the future, considering the key role that active learning will play as learning evolves to incorporate more collaboration and engagement is vital. In our upcoming webinar, you’ll discover key insights from seasoned L&D leaders who have refined the art of engaging online learners in collaborative, cohort-based learning environments. Our speakers will explore:

  • The power of active learning and how it strengthens knowledge uptake and retention
  • The intersection between cohort-based learning, social learning, and active learning
  • Fostering digitally collaborative environments within the workplace
  • Success stories and challenges encountered by learning leaders who are striving to leverage active learning to its full extent
